Ex-IGP Mamun, former OC Hasan remanded in separate killing cases

DHAKA, March 19, 2025 (BSS) - A court here today placed former inspector general of police (IGP) Chowdhury Abdullah Al-Mamun on a four-day remand and former officer-in-charge (OC) of Jatrabari Police Station Abul Hasan on a two-day remand respectively in two separate killing cases.

Of the two, Mamun was remanded in Md Sayem Hossain murder case, while Abul Hasan was remanded in Russel Bakaul killing case, both filed with the Jatrabari Police Station.

Dhaka Metropolitan Magistrate Shahin Reza passed the orders this noon. The court also showed Mamun arrested in four murder and murder attempt case.

According to the case documents, Md Sayem Hossain joined anti-discrimination student movement rally in front of Hanif Flyover Toll Plaza in Jatrabari area on July 19, 2024. He got shot and died on the spot. His mother Sheuli Akter filed the case on August 27.

Russel Bakaul was killed in police firing in front of Jatrabari Police Station on August 5, 2024.
